Website Design-should be more than a pretty face

Monday, January 4th, 2010

So often I hear business owners make the statement “the internet is the future.”  Well that’s true only if we’ve time-warped back a decade. The internet is now and it’s growing faster than any other medium out there.  We all know that deep in our hearts because we use the internet for everything every day. But business owners are busy people who have lured themselves into thinking that a great website design is something that can wait. If you own a business and want success now or anytime in the immediate future, RIGHT NOW is when you should be taking a serious look at your website design.
Philadelphia website design companies are a dime a dozen.  It’s total confusion for the business owners trying to make a wise buying decision when choosing among website design companies. Business owners don’t understand why one Philadelphia website design company makes a proposal for a site for $300  and another company submits a proposal for 2, 3, or X times more for a website design that seems relatively the same.  No wonder they are telling themselves it’s okay to wait. It’s a painful decision when you don’t understand what makes a website design great, mediocre or nothing better than an online brochure.
The majority of Philadelphia website design companies out there are graphic designers. They have been educated on how to make a site look pretty on the front-end – the side the public sees. That’s important no doubt.  The back-end of a site, actually, matters more because it’s the spiders that decide which website will get the best organic placement.  You can have the best looking site and be the best in your industry, but if the back-side of your site isn’t handled properly, you’re going to miss out the potential buyers that are looking for a company like you.
An easy way of knowing if you’re talking to a Philadelphia website design company worth its salt is asking about their track record with other clients. The Philadelphia website design companies that are loved by their customers are the ones that convert searches into contacts (aka conversions.)  These companies are being provided with valuable business intelligence reports called analytics that show a wealth of data about their site’s performance.  With this information, the mystery of how to win is removed and they’re empowered with the data that tells them how their performing now and how to keep winning in the internet world.

Importance of paying attention to your Pay Per Click website traffic!

Tuesday, December 22nd, 2009

So I am sitting here preparing for one of the meetings I have tomorrow. I am in disbelief that a person could of spent as much money as they could of on Pay Per click through out the whole nation. I am not in shock about them spending the money, but the person who is there webmaster allows this traffic to go to a site, that should be a picture of me instead of what they have. How do these so called webmaster, web designers, and CTO not understand to look at the data daily! Because they do not know what they are doing. Tomm I am going to tell you about the meeting I had today with a web designer, that wouldn’t know what the adobe kit is!

I am looking at Google analytics, and there are key words they are and have been Pay Per Clicking with 100% Bounce rate, and majority over 50% bounce rate and above. You have to track all information everyone, there is no excuse you install it one time and let the tracking begin. This 50% means if there budget is 10k a month about 5k of it never really has a chance to convert. Of course I am summing this up you have to look at the over all individual key word bounce rate and that break the data down by cost per click. But for novices I am summing this up about pay per click.

All you have to do is make sure you use the data to win on the Internet space. Do not drive traffic to a site that people are leaving right away. The issue is not your key word it is your site!

I ask on every call the same question. I am going to give it to you all. What is easier to do double traffic to your site, or double conversions? (Meaning the site already has some traffic, also conversions means an action Phone call, email, or a purchase).

The majority say double traffic. It is simple double your conversions, make your site answer the people better than it already does. Use the data and make your site better for every key word with a high bounce rate.I use this analogy you have a overweight person that is trying to get a hot date. Is it easier to tell them to drop 25 pounds, than show them to people, or just keep going to one person after another until some one says yes. I hope the Gym was your answer, it is easier to double your chance if you look and are delivering the correct message! No difference on the web!

If everyone pays attention to the traffic to their site, it will give you the answers on what to do.  Yes you have to research your competitors but you have to do that any way. Before you start driving Pay per click philadelphia or any where else in the nation do the following.

When starting a Pay Per click Campaign in Philadelphia or any other area, make sure Google analytic  is on your site. Make sure you have your Pay Per click set the correct way, or you will get a Data set not read and than it becomes worthless to you. As you are doing your Pay per click look at the bounce rate on every single key word. Any that are real high you are not relevant for that key word to where you are driving the traffic to(meaning the page the traffic from that keyword is going). Simple solution change that page!

Why High Quality Web Design is So Important

Tuesday, October 20th, 2009

There once was a time on the Internet when web design wasn’t very important. Maybe a decade ago or so, the main thing you had to do was just have a website. That factor alone would give you a strong advantage in the marketplace, and you’d have a leg up on your competition who didn’t yet make the move to the online realm. However, those times have long since passed. Now merely having a website isn’t enough. You need to make use of high quality web design to help your business stand out, attract new customers and ultimately be successful on the Internet.

One factor playing into this is that the Internet has expanded greatly over the years. Now nearly every business has a website or multiple online presences, and millions of individuals do as well. That means that there is a huge supply of competition, and it also means that the bar has been raised in terms of what quality web design actually is. Today, if you have an unattractive website or one that doesn’t operate easily you are going to scare away all of your visitors and you’ll lose out on all of that extra money.

Your web design needs to be setup in such a way that the most important information is easily found, and all of the pages can be quickly navigated between. Put yourself in the shoes of a visitor who comes to your site. What are they really seeking out, and how can you provide that for them? It’s about meeting their needs by implementing specific solutions.

Web design will help you take any website visitor and draw that person into the path you want them to take. If you’re trying to sell a product, it should be simple and intuitive to continue to the sales page and make an order. If you want people to send you an email for a quote, getting to that online form has to be as easy as possible. Whatever your goals are, you need to use your web design to bring people to that.

Of course, being attractive and visually pleasing is important in and of itself. A site that has contrasting colors or a poor layout or scheme isn’t going to draw much attention or interest. More often than not people will see a bad looking website and they will just click immediately on the back button. That’s because the site sends off vibes that it is unprofessional, it doesn’t care or perhaps it doesn’t know any better.

None of that is any good to try to establish your brand and your image, or to find new customers and prospects. Therefore an aesthetically pleasing website is extremely important. It will add value to your image and it will make you seem professional and trustworthy.

As you can see, high quality web design plays a huge role in your online success. A poorly designed website will send your visitors running off as they have difficulty finding what they are looking for, as they don’t appreciate the quality or appearance of your website and as you fail to successfully convert them in the ways that you’d like to. Therefore, take all steps necessary to ensure that your website has a unique, top notch web design.
